Stability

Stability is one of the main features that a stroller ought to have. The stroller must be able to remain upright even when it's being pushed. This is because it will keep the stroller from tripping and falling over. Stability of a stroller may be affected by many aspects, including the design and materials employed. Additionally, the size of the wheels determines the stability of the stroller. Strollers with large wheels are more stable than those with smaller wheels.

Four-wheeled strollers are the most stable. They are more sturdy and less likely to fall over even with the extra weight of children. They can also travel over rough terrain, such as bumpy curbs or sidewalks. A 4-wheeled stroller has a lower center of gravity than a 3-wheeled stroller, making it more stable.

Many strollers have been designed to be easy-to-maneuver and to have a sleek appearance that makes them more appealing. However, some manufacturers make and sell strollers that do not meet federal safety standards. These strollers could pose a risk for children.

According to the Danny Keysar Child Product Safety Notification Act section 104 of the Consumer Product Safety Act, the CPSC must issue standards that are like or more rigorous than the existing voluntary standards. In the end, the Commission has recently proposed an updated version of the ASTM stroller standard, ASTM F833-13b. The new standard that is mandatory includes more stringent tests for the wheel detachment, the parking brake, and stability than the voluntary standard.

Safety

Over the years, strollers have been the subject of many safety concerns. Millions of strollers were recalls due to issues such as broken locking mechanisms, strangulation or entrapment hazards and laceration or amputation risk and insecure seatbelts, as well as the risk that the seats could fall off from the frames. These issues have caused new strollers to be regulated by stricter safety regulations and older models to receive improved warnings.

3 wheeler strollers are generally safe, however as with any product, it is important to look for the indications of a good safe design. Be sure to verify whether the brakes can be easily accessible by you and are difficult for your child to reach (and do not hang bags from the handles). Be aware of pinch points that could entangle tiny fingers.

Make sure the axles and wheels are strong and not easily damaged. The wheels are the primary cause of stroller accidents therefore it is essential that they can handle bumps and uneven surfaces.
